Hypersonic Weapons

Hypersonic weapons are capable of traveling at speeds exceeding Mach 5, allowing them to penetrate enemy defenses with unprecedented speed and reach. At the Paris Airshow 2025, attendees will witness the display of various hypersonic weapons, including air-launched missiles, ground-launched systems, and advanced propulsion technologies.

The Impact of Digitalization on the Aerospace Industry at the Paris Airshow 2025

1. Introduction

The Paris Airshow is a biennial event that showcases the latest advancements in the aerospace industry. In recent years, digitalization has had a major impact on the industry, and this trend is expected to continue at the 2025 show.

2. Digital Twins

Digital twins are virtual representations of physical objects or systems. They can be used to simulate and test new designs, optimize operations, and predict maintenance needs. The use of digital twins is expected to grow significantly in the aerospace industry in the coming years.

3. Artificial Intelligence

Artificial intelligence (AI) is being used to automate a variety of tasks in the aerospace industry, from design to manufacturing to maintenance. AI-powered systems can help improve efficiency, reduce costs, and improve safety.

4. Additive Manufacturing

Additive manufacturing, also known as 3D printing, is a process that uses digital files to create physical objects. Additive manufacturing is expected to revolutionize the way that aerospace components are manufactured. It can reduce lead times, lower costs, and improve product quality.

5. Blockchain

Blockchain is a distributed ledger technology that can be used to securely store and track data. Blockchain is being used to develop new ways to manage supply chains, track maintenance records, and secure payments in the aerospace industry.

6. Cloud Computing

Cloud computing is a model for delivering computing resources over the internet. Cloud computing is being used to provide access to powerful computing resources for aerospace engineers and researchers.

7. Cybersecurity

Cybersecurity is a critical concern for the aerospace industry. As the industry becomes more digitalized, it becomes more vulnerable to cyberattacks. The Paris Airshow 2025 will showcase the latest cybersecurity technologies and best practices.

8. Sustainable Aviation

Digitalization can help to make aviation more sustainable. For example, digital twins can be used to optimize flight routes and reduce fuel consumption. AI can be used to develop new materials and technologies that make aircraft more efficient.

9. Digital Workforce

Digitalization is also having a major impact on the workforce in the aerospace industry. New skills are needed to design, build, and operate digital systems. The Paris Airshow 2025 will highlight the need for a new generation of digital workers in the aerospace industry.

Camera Quality and Resolution

### Camera Stabilization
When choosing a drone for aerial photography, stability is paramount. An unstable drone leads to shaky footage that detracts from the visual experience. The most desirable drones are equipped with either mechanical or electronic image stabilization (EIS). Mechanical stabilization involves a gimbal, a motorized mount that keeps the camera steady as the drone moves. EIS, on the other hand, uses software to digitally stabilize the footage. While drones with mechanical stabilization generally provide smoother footage, EIS can be an adequate solution for those on a budget.

### Camera Resolution and Frame Rates
In addition to stabilization, camera resolution and frame rates play a crucial role in determining image quality. Resolution refers to the number of pixels a camera can capture, with higher resolutions resulting in sharper and more detailed images. Frame rate refers to the number of frames a camera captures per second, with higher frame rates producing smoother video. For aerial photography, resolutions of 12MP or higher and frame rates of 30fps or higher are recommended.

### Sensors and Lenses
The final piece of the camera puzzle is the sensor and lens. The sensor size directly impacts the amount of light the camera can capture, with larger sensors resulting in better low-light performance and a shallower depth of field. Lenses, on the other hand, affect the field of view and optical quality of the images. Prime lenses offer a fixed focal length and typically provide superior image quality, while zoom lenses offer greater flexibility but may sacrifice some image quality at higher zoom levels. Understanding the interplay between sensor size, lens focal length, and aperture will help you choose the best drone camera for your needs.

Feature Impact
Stabilization Smoothness of footage
Resolution Sharpness and detail of images
Frame Rate Smoothness of video
Sensor Size Low-light performance and depth of field
Lens Type Field of view and image quality
